Jomie   30 #2 Posted November 30, 2017 Do you mean text messages? If so, and you have a laptop you might want to look at CopyTrans. The programme has several components and it is Contacts that will do the job. They can be saved in various forms, including pdf. It is free initially but after a set number of uses a charge is made - it is not very expensive. Re saving emails, presumably they are on IMAP on the iPad? If you have a laptop, just download them onto it via POP3. They can then be dragged/dropped into a folder and saved. Share this post Link to post Share on other sites Share this content via...

Jomie   30 #4 Posted November 30, 2017 (edited) The iPad doesn’t have a USB port so you will need to purchase a connector. Is this of any use? If it is private messages from here that you want to save, you can copy and paste the text to Notes, Pages or similar.
